Bank warns of more frequent interest rate rises

  Bank of England says its outlook remains Brexit dependent The Bank of England has kept interest rates on hold at 0.75%after declaring that economic growth in the UK has been stronger than expected. The Bank is predicting that inflation…

5 year fixed rates now almost as cheap as 2 year fixed rates

  Should you consider locking in for longer ? Five-year fixed mortgage rates have plummeted over recent months and are now almost as cheap as two-year deals, prompting many borrowers to consider locking in for longer. The average two-year fixed…
